What is particulate testing for medical devices? 

Particulate testing for medical devices services is the analytical assessment of visible and sub‑visible particles that may be present in or released from a medical device, formulation, or container‑closure system. These particles can originate from raw materials, manufacturing processes, packaging, transport, storage, or device use. 

Particulate matter testing is commonly used to quantify and characterize particles by size, count, and morphology using standardized laboratory methods. A particulate matter test provides objective data used to evaluate particulate burden under controlled test conditions. 

Importance of particulate matter test for patient safety and why it is performed 

Particles associated with medical devices may interact with the body depending on the intended use, route of administration, and duration of contact. Particulate matter testing medical device studies are performed to assess potential risks related to embolic events, tissue irritation, inflammatory responses, or visual impairment in sensitive applications. 

A medical device particulate testing program is commonly performed to: 

  • Address regulatory requirements related to product cleanliness 
  • Evaluate particulate release during simulated use 
  • Enable risk assessments for injectable, implantable, or ophthalmic products 
  • Monitor manufacturing and process‑related variability

Our particulate analysis methodologies

Applus+ Laboratories performs particulate testing for medical devices using validated analytical methodologies commonly applied across the medical and pharmaceutical industries. 

Microscopic particle count assay 

Microscopic particle analysis involves filtration of the test sample followed by optical or electron microscopy. This particulate matter test enables visual confirmation, particle sizing, and morphological classification.

Other methodologies 

Additional methodologies commonly used for particulate testing for medical devices include: 

  • Membrane filtration with optical microscopy 
  • SEM analysis for particulate morphology and composition 
  • Image‑based particle analysis systems 

Method selection depends on particle size range, material type, and test objectives. 

Key standards for medical devices particulate testing 

Particulate testing for medical devices is aligned with international pharmacopeial and industry standards that define particle limits, test methods, and evaluation criteria. 

USP <788> for particulate matter in injections 

USP <788> specifies methods and limits for sub‑visible particulate matter in injectable products. Light obscuration and microscopic particle count assays are defined under this chapter for liquid parenteral products.
